What if I am a Reserve or National Guard spouse in IET? If you are mobilized full-time and assigned at an IET installation, thank you for your sacrifice. You are going through a transition not only to a new IET assignment but adapting to full-time Army service, often away from your home. The bulk of this handbook applies to you. Material on regular Army services may be beneficial to you as most military privileges are available to you now. Check out these websites for more information:
Please see some of the websites at the end of the book to answer questions on TRICARE, ACS help, or normal installation life. Know that our training units rely heavily on Reserve and National Guard organizations to continue their important training missions in this time of war.
